Python File flush() Method
Example
You can clear the buffer when writing to a file:
    f = open("myfile.txt", "a")
f.write("Now the file has one more line!")
    f.flush()
f.write("...and another one!")

Definition and Usage
The flush() method cleans out the internal 
buffer.
